VIDEO - Rob Hecksel, a retired firefighter diagnosed with pancreatic cancer in February, was hoping for a long second career as a social worker.
He’s trying to compress that mission into his remaining time.
Hecksel, 51, of Lansing was a battalion chief with the Lansing Fire Department. He retired three years ago after a 25-year career but wanted to find another job that he loved and that improved the lives of others.

Investigators were looking for the cause of a fire responsible for an estimated $50,000 in damage to a Dottie Drive home Thursday afternoon.
Firefighters from Selah, Gleed and the Army’s Yakima Training Center went to the fire at the single-story home just west of town around 3:40 p.m. Smoke was coming from inside the house and under the roof eaves, said Selah Deputy Fire Chief Jim Lange.

Everett firefighters battled a three-alarm blaze at the Colby Square Apartments in the 2200 block of Colby Avenue late Thursday night.
The Everett Fire Marshal said that all 14 units in the two-story apartment were left uninhabitable. He didn't know the number of residents who lived there, but he noted that the Red Cross was on the scene to help those displaced.
